Your atomizer probably isn't broken in yet if you just got your stuff. It can take a day or so in some cases. I really doubt it's necessary to clean it at this point unless you're just doing it to get a flavor out of it.

If you're going to be messing with juices, go to a beauty supply store and buy a box of gloves, you can get a big box of 100 for under 10.00...I actually just got a box for 5.00 on sale. (They come in handy for LOTS of things, spray painting, handling raw meat when cooking, etc.) I used 24mg juice when I made my first batch and I did have redness/rash where I had inadvertantly rubbed my arm. I think I was pushing up my sleeve, I didn't even realize it. I've seen posts where some people get juice in their mouth and as far as I know, no one has croaked yet. If you get it on bare skin just wash it well.

Make sure your cartridges are moist, dry ones will also cause the burnt taste and you might want to make sure the filler isn't sticking to the atty, which will also cause it.

I've taken the filling out of my cartridges and put it back in also. If you don't get it in right, it will really affect your draw. I won't do that again until I get much more proficient at it. The ones I didn't mess with work really well, the ones I did are hit or miss. You can use a syringe with warm water and flood the cartridges a few times to clean them and then you're not messing with the filler.

1. It takes usually a half day to two days to break in an atomizer, so don't be too concerned about your initial experience.

2. Every time you clean the atomizer it is somewhat like a new atomizer again in that you have to put a few drops of juice on it and prime it.

3. Washing the filler and reusing is fine. We all do that. You can get a $6 bag of polyestor batting at Wal-Mart for new filler that will last like 2 years.

4. I get juice (24mg) on my hands all the time and have for months with no adverse effects. I just wash it off and have several moist wash cloths around the house just for that purpose and I keep pre-moistened wipes in the car, also.
